tns:connect timeout occurred
时间: 2023-04-26 15:02:15 浏览: 158
tns:connect timeout occurred 意思是连接超时。这通常是由于网络问题或服务器故障引起的。您可以尝试重新连接或检查网络连接是否正常。如果问题仍然存在,请联系技术支持以获取帮助。
相关问题
ora-12170: tns:connect timeout occurred
ORA-12170错误表示连接到Oracle数据库时发生了超时错误。这可能是由于网络问题、数据库服务器故障或客户端配置不正确等原因引起的。要解决此问题,可以尝试重新启动数据库服务器、检查网络连接或检查客户端配置是否正确。如果问题仍然存在,请联系数据库管理员或技术支持人员以获取更多帮助。
cx_Oracle.DatabaseError: ORA-12170: TNS:Connect timeout occurred
这个错误通常表示连接到Oracle数据库时出现了超时。可能的原因包括:
1. 数据库服务器不可用或已关闭。
2. 网络连接存在问题,可能是网络中断、防火墙或代理服务器等。
3. 数据库服务名称或主机名不正确。
解决方法:
1. 确认数据库服务器是否可用,以及网络连接是否正常。
2. 检查防火墙或代理服务器的设置,确保可以访问数据库服务器。
3. 检查连接字符串中的数据库服务名称或主机名是否正确。
如果以上方法无法解决问题,请尝试增加连接超时时间,例如:
```python
import cx_Oracle
conn = cx_Oracle.connect(user='username', password='password', dsn='database', timeout=60)
```
其中timeout参数表示连接超时时间(以秒为单位)。
阅读全文